As if Qarabag FK's task wasn't already daunting enough tonight, as they seek to overturn a five-goal deficit at St James' Park in the Champions League play-off second leg against Newcastle United, the club made a strange preparation choice ahead of the fixture.

The 2500-mile journey is less than favourable, no matter how you look at it, but Newcastle managed to deal with it admirably last week, roaring into a 5-0 lead at half-time in the fixture out in Baku.

The Magpies landed in Azerbaijan the day before the game and took time to undergo a training session on the pitch to get acclimatised.

However, chasing the tie, the Azerbaijani side have taken a very different approach, training in Baku before flying to England.

Qarabag are going to be sleepwalking around the pitch tonight

The Qarabag side arrived in Newcastle last night at around 10:40pm, which is 2:40am Azerbaijan time. The game kicks off at 8pm tonight, which, to the Qarabag players, is essentially midnight.

Landing less than 24 hours before the game with such a huge time difference is hardly ideal preparation.
